Minnesota's climate is a major factor for roof repair. Freezing and thawing cycles can crack shingles and warp materials. Heavy snow loads put stress on your roof structure. Summer heat and storms bring wind and hail damage. We fix roofs that have seen it all. We know the best materials for Minnesota's weather extremes. Some asphalt shingles can become brittle in extreme cold common in Minneapolis. Look for shingles rated for lower temperatures and high wind resistance. Avoid lightweight shingles that may not withstand Minnesota's harsh winters. We can guide you to durable options.

Common issues include ice dams, wind damage, and shingle wear from freeze-thaw cycles. Heavy snow can also cause structural stress. We address these specific problems to ensure your roof is sound.
